Safety Beyond School

Correspondence (Online)

Self-Paced

NZQA Level 3

Best suited for: Students leaving school and moving into trades-based industries, apprenticeships, labouring roles, logistics, warehousing, construction, automotive, engineering, manufacturing, infrastructure, or other hands-on work environments.

Delivery: Online learning with tutor support available. No practical component. Printable learning materials available for students who prefer a hard copy.

Why this pack matters

Young people entering trades-based and practical workplaces need to understand risk, responsibility, and the impact of poor decision-making before they arrive on site.

This pack helps students build foundational workplace safety awareness, including drug and alcohol-related issues and practical risk assessment. It supports students to move into mahi with stronger judgement, better safety language, and a better understanding of what employers expect.

NZQA units Included:

22316 | 4 credits Demonstrate knowledge of the management of drug and alcohol related problems in the workplace

30265 | 8 credits Apply health & safety risk assessment to a job role

School Leavers Readiness

Correspondence (Online)

Self-Paced

NZQA Level 2

Best suited for: Students preparing to leave school during Term 3 and move into work, training, or other practical pathways.

Delivery: Online learning with tutor support available. No practical component. No extra delivery required from teachers. Printable learning materials available for students who prefer a hard copy.

Why this pack matters

Many schools are seeing a significant number of students preparing to leave during Term 3, often because they are ready to move into mahi, training, or other practical pathways.

The School Leavers Readiness Pack gives these students a supported online option to complete additional Level 2 credits while also building practical skills for their next step.

This pack is ideal for students who are close to achieving their Level 2 qualification and need a focused, manageable way to gain further credits without requiring practical course delivery.

The learning focuses on future planning, time management, stress management, and employment agreements.

Students can complete the work online from school or home, with tutor support available through ITS. Schools can use this as a flexible Term 3 intervention for students who are at risk of leaving without the credits they need.

This pack can also work well as a school holiday learning project for students who need a focused way to keep progressing before fully transitioning out of school.


NZQA units Included:

10781 | 3 credits Produce a plan for own future directions

12349 | 3 credits Demonstrate knowledge of time management

12355 | 3 credits Describe strategies for managing stress

1979 | 3 credits Describe employment agreements
